Reno’s LEAD with Horses will host its 4th annual Horses and Harmony concert today, promising an evening filled with live music, local food, and community support.

The event took place at their newly purchased location at 2575 Lakeshore Drive in Washoe Valley, and the organization has 3 equine-assisted programs: adaptive riding, equine-assisted counseling, and equine-assisted youth development. Also, the region it supports is northern Nevada. 

The concert featured performances from Decoy, a well-known local band, whose vibrant melodies are expected to bring energy and excitement to the evening.

Organizers hope to use the funds raised to continue providing therapeutic programs for children whose needs aren't being met in traditional settings.

LEAD with Horses improves the social, emotional, physical, and behavioral development of children, youth, and adults in Northern Nevada through high-quality equine-assisted services delivered in a safe, welcoming, and inclusive environment.
